Focusing on demand for exchange traded funds that offer high dividends at lower volatility, Nikko Asset Management announced today that it is offering a smart beta ETF linked to a customized MSCI index designed for this purpose. This new ETF, Listed Index Fund MSCI Japan Equity High Dividend Low Volatility, will be listed on the Tokyo Stock Exchange on December 1.

Portfolio construction for the new ETF is based on investing in the components of the recently developed MSCI Japan IMI Custom Liquidity and Yield Low Volatility Index in order to closely track the movement of stocks offering higher dividend yields at lower volatility. Restricting the eligible universe to stocks that combine relatively high dividend yields with a given level of liquidity, the smart beta index employs a weight optimization approach that aims to minimize overall price volatility. The weight for each individual share can only vary between 0.05% and 1.00% of the total. Another core characteristic is that the index excludes all financial stocks such as banks, insurers or brokerages, in addition to J-REITs (real estate investment trusts). Total holdings in the linked High-Dividend Low-Volatility ETF is expected to be around 120–130. Holders of the ETF will receive dividends four times each year in January, April, July, and October.
